Output b91ad23c90f53f0d1d0135fc9065ee7018709d22b84df858513c7d005f2a80f2:0

value
515914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 651df1606d5bbcc0e3284344dcae1c7373640a4b OP_EQUAL
address
3Aug3PMYt71pLxszQunN9sPTEw8xVFjVr8
transaction
b91ad23c90f53f0d1d0135fc9065ee7018709d22b84df858513c7d005f2a80f2
spent
true